Cananea Airport (CNA) to Hamburg (HAM) Flight Distance
The flight distance from Cananea Airport (CNA) in Cananea Airport, Mexico to Hamburg Airport (HAM) in Hamburg, Germany is 8,978 kilometers (5,579 miles / 4,848 nautical miles). The estimated flight time for this route is approximately 12h, flying north northeast at a heading of 31°.
